Q: Why was my plugin's canary deploy blocked even though my tests passed?

A: The Hollowgate platform gates canaries on runtime signals, not just test results. A canary is held if error rates exceed baseline by 2%, p95 latency regresses beyond the configured budget, or crash-loop signatures appear within the first 30 minutes. Plugin authors cannot override these gates, but you can request a threshold review for latency-heavy plugins. The full gating ruleset, evaluation windows, and appeal process are documented on the page linked here.

dashboard of tawef-hagug = https://superset.norvadyn.local/display/projects/build/ticket/build/spaces/ticket/1e989f0e6c200d20fc4ae06b

- [ ] **Step 7: Breaker override escrow.** After sealing the signing keys for the Tallgrove upstream API circuit breaker, confirm the support team can force the breaker open during a full outage. The override bundle lives in the sealed escrow drawer and is useless without its unlock phrase. Two ceremony witnesses must initial this step before proceeding. The escrow bundle is decrypted with the recovery passphrase that follows.

vault phrase of kahip-kahop = holath-quenmir

Hi all — quick note from the Ostrey Park front desk for contractors on site this week. The evacuation-chair store next to Stair B needs to stay clear while you're working on that corridor, so please move kit through rather than stacking it there. If you need to open the store to shift the chair temporarily, the door-pass code is below.

staff pass of kawip-hawef = bdg-QLP-2

Handover Note — Logistics Transition

Hi Priya, as I wrap up, here's where things stand on moving from Kestrel Freight to Duneport Logistics. Contracts are signed, and the Telmora warehouse cutover happens end of next month. Sales leads should tell customers shipping windows tighten by two days — a selling point, honestly. Watch the first invoice cycle closely; Duneport's billing format differs. One more thing the sales leads should know about where this fits in our wider plans.

confidential, kagup-bafog: Fraaxax Group is in early talks to buy Soroxox Group for about $343.8 million. The Olidor launch date is June 14, and nothing goes to the press before then. Legal wants the Aldmirek Logistics term sheet signed before July 23.